English: These opening-closing question marks are used in Spanish. If missing, the grammar is wrong. The opening-closing technique is also used for exclamation marks in Spanish.
Español: En español y algunas otras lenguas relacionadas se utiliza el signo de interrogación de apertura para indicar el comienzo de una cláusula interrogativa. Esto permite modificar la entonación para transmitir oralmente el significado adecuado. Otras lenguas modifican el orden de las palabras y/o añaden partículas para el mismo propósito.
